Output 23a170db1894811581deb50ae5efeaa9c8e3a525410b4997fdc8a6b90d4f029d:0

value
458999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bea95ffad526c84d786620c120c25294d772d621 OP_EQUAL
address
3K59DNG5hE7dKxWRWUNkK3T2ddgN3aY3j4
transaction
23a170db1894811581deb50ae5efeaa9c8e3a525410b4997fdc8a6b90d4f029d
spent
true